Product Description

The Bently Nevada 330130-080-12-05 3300 XL Standard Extension Cable is designed to work seamlessly with the 3300 XL Transducer System, ensuring stable and reliable signal transmission for accurate measurements in industrial applications. It is specifically used in fluid-film bearing machines, speed measurement applications, and compression systems, providing long-term stability and precision. The 3300 XL extension cable incorporates several advanced design improvements, offering superior mechanical strength and durability compared to previous designs.

Key Features

  • Cable Length Options: Available in lengths from 3 meters up to 8.5 meters, accommodating various installation requirements.
  • Durability: The FluidLoc cable design enhances tensile strength and prolongs cable life.
  • High-Strength Connection: Patented TipLoc molding method ensures a robust bond between the probe tip and body, providing more secure cable attachment.
  • Compatibility: Fully interchangeable with other 3300 XL Series components and backward compatible with previous systems.
  • Safety Certifications: CSA, ATEX, and IECEx approvals ensure safe operation in explosive and hazardous environments.
  • Versatile Temperature Range: Suitable for a wide range of temperatures, ensuring reliable operation in various industrial systems.

Technical Specifications

Dimensions and Weight

Item Specification
Cable Length 8.0 meters (26.2 feet)
Weight 0.272 kg
Cable Type FluidLoc cable
Cable Protector With connector protector

General Information

Item Specification
Compatible Probe ETR probe compatible
Cable Design TipLoc molding method, CableLoc design
Pull Strength 330 N (75 lbf)
Safety Certifications CSA, ATEX, IECEx
Compatibility Fully interchangeable with other 3300 XL Series components
Environmental Suitability Suitable for a wide range of temperatures and harsh conditions
Applications Fluid-film bearing machines, speed measurement, compression systems
